# Clock skew handling for Forgeline build agents.
# Support: when customers report "build finished before it started,"
# it's skew between agents, not corruption. The scheduler tolerates
# drift up to a threshold, warns in a middle band, and quarantines
# agents beyond it. Do not raise limits to silence tickets; fix NTP
# on the agent instead. Thresholds are defined below.

limits module of haweg-badug:
RATE_LIMITS = {
    "casox": 339,
    "wenix": 653,
    "rusok": 650,
    "lamix": 337,
    "aldvan": 753,
}

Subject: Churn in the Holloway Pilot

Team — pilot churn hit 11 percent last month, above the 7 percent threshold. Exit interviews cite onboarding friction, not price. Branch managers should tighten first-week follow-ups immediately. We review continuation of the pilot at Friday's call. Please treat the confidential planning note appended below as restricted.

board note of bajop-yaweg: The western region missed its Pelys quota by 58.0 percent last quarter. Pelysek Foods plans to raise the Belius list price by 44.0 percent in July. The steering committee signed off on a budget of $133.8 million for Project Pelax. The renewal with Zoraelix Systems closes at $61.9 million a year, 12.7 percent above the last contract.

Onboarding note for the release manager: the Quillgate load balancer probes each Fernvale API node at /healthz every ten seconds; two consecutive failures pull a node from rotation. During releases, drain nodes manually rather than letting probes fail, since flapping trips the Ashmoor alert chain. If the health-check admin panel locks you out mid-release, use the break-glass login, which requires the recovery passphrase printed below.

vault phrase of bafop-kahop = sormir-frador